Finally, the high-pressure versions of the MiFlex hoses are being launched.

These are really nice pieces of kit, that look even better than the low-pressure versions thanks to a tighter weave and being only the width of a pencil. I have been doing some prototype testing on these for the guys for a couple of months and am very impressed. Even when your air/gas is turned on, the hose is just as flexible as when it is not pressurised.

The Xtreme-Hi hoses will be out for May 09, not sure if that will be worldwide or not.

I am presuming your two-gauge console is a pressure gauge and a depth gauge? Why wouldn't a Miflex Xtreme-Hi hose fit? The high-pressure hose to the SPG part of the two-console set-up should just be a straight swap for the Miflex, and the depth gauge is totally separate anyway and in no way connected to the cylinder, it is just mounted next to the SPG for convenience.
